OpenAI New Phone Reportedly Fast-Tracked for 2027 Launch
The News
According to a 9to5Mac report, OpenAI new hardware device, often referred to as an "AI phone," is being fast-tracked for launch in 2027. This would represent a significant expansion beyond ChatGPT and into consumer hardware.
What We Know
The device is expected to be an AI-first smartphone or companion device that integrates ChatGPT and OpenAI models at the system level. Rather than running traditional apps, the device would be controlled primarily through natural language interactions with AI.
The Vision
OpenAI hardware strategy appears to be building devices that eliminate the need for traditional app interfaces. Instead of opening apps, users would tell the AI what they want and the AI would complete tasks autonomously.
Market Implications
If successful, an OpenAI phone could disrupt the smartphone market dominated by Apple and Google. However, building consumer hardware is fundamentally different from building software, and OpenAI will face significant challenges in manufacturing, supply chain, and distribution.
